开源中国社区收录了大量的开源软件,您会发现,其中绝大多数托管在sf.net、GitHub、code.google.com等站点上。其实不错的开源托管站点还真的是不少。笔者为您总结了如下国外知名的开源项目托管网站。
托管站点Top20如下:
1. SourceForge
SF为大家所熟知,开源项目的大本营,SF托管至少28万个开源项目,一天的下载量超过200万。
2. GitHub
GitHub托管使用Git版本控制系统的公开和私有项目。 目前该网站托管超过170万存储项目,包括许多开源软件。
3. Google Code
Google提供免费的使用Subversion或是Mercurial版本控制系统的开源项目托管服务。 它提供2G的存储空间,整合了代码查看工具、wiki、问题跟踪。Google Code站点也提供了大量的Googe自己的APIs和其他开发工具。
4. Eclipse Labs
同样由Google Code托管, Eclipse Labs 是建立在Ecipse平台上的开源项目存储。提示,这些并不是官方的Eclipse基金会项目。
5. BitBucket
类似GitHub, BitBucket托管公开和私有项目。在这个站点上,开源项目和私有项目的用户少于5人,则免费。它托管了超过4.8万个项目,多数可在站点上搜索。
6. LaunchPad
由Ubuntu的东家Canonical维护,LaunchPad目标是运行在Ubuntu上的项目。它托管超过2.1万个使用Bazaar版本控制系统的项目。
7. Codehaus
Codehaus定义自己为“开源软件的协作开发环境”。托管需要审查,是否符合站点的声明。
8. RubyForge
从名字您就可猜出,它托管Ruby程序语言开发的开源项目,目前托管项目超过9000个。
9. Tigris
Tigris具有很强的专注性,仅限于“为协作软件开发创建更好的工具”。它目前包括700个项目。
10. BerliOS Developer
BerliOS Developer为各种类型的开源项目提供免费的托管服务,并且支持的语言众多。目前它托管的项目超过4600个。
11. Savannah—GNU
Savannah定义自己为“官方GNU软件的开发、维护、发行的中心”。它托管410个官方GNU项目。
12. Savannah—non-GNU
与Savannah-GNU相对应,Savannah-non-GNU托管其他类型的开源项目,总是超过2800个。
13. Gna!
如果你访问过Savannah项目,Gna!会非常类似,因为它使用同样的软件,并同样关注GNU相关的项目。目前它托管1350个项目。
14. CodePlex
由微软托管,Codepex提供微软开发的开源软件和一些社区项目。它提供下载的项目超过2万。
15. Java.net
最早由Sun公司创立,Java.net托管和链接大量的Java相关的项目。另外,它也包括许多的博客、论坛和其他Java社区资源。
16. Gitorious
Gitorious提供使用Git版本控制系统的开源项目免费的托管服务。它托管了一些著名的软件,包括OpenSUSE、Qt相关项目。
17. TuxFamily
TuxFamily为开源软件提供免费托管服务,托管数量超过2300。提示,这是一个法语组织。
18. KnowlegeForge
KnowlegeForge规模较小,托管250个项目。它由Open Knowledge基金会支持,使用多种版本控制系统。
19. OSOR
OSOR是欧盟站点,目前托管200个开源项目,链接项目超过2500个。该站点包含自由和开源软件的相关搜索和新闻。
20. OW2
OW2(the ObjectWeb Forge)提供基础软件相关的开源项目托管服务,目前托管188个项目。
分享到:
相关推荐
FSEN是开发网站的开源项目,为开源项目提供站点托管服务。 您还可以将 FSEN 作为内容管理系统用于: 您自己的开源项目。 您组织的内部项目和文档管理系统。 您的个人网站或您组织的官方网站。 我们正在 Apache...
3. 多站点支持:Caddy可以在单个实例下托管多个域名和子域,提供灵活的路由规则。 4. 基于中间件的架构:Caddy通过一系列可插拔的中间件来处理HTTP请求,这些中间件可以执行各种任务,如静态文件服务、反向代理、...
Dubbo和Nacos是两个知名开源项目,它们都选择了Docsite作为其官方站点的构建工具。这一选择表明,Docsite在处理大规模开源项目的文档管理和发布方面具有足够的稳定性和效率。 ### 五、使用步骤 1. **安装Docsite**...
标题 "开源项目-spf13-hugo.zip" 暗示了我们正在讨论的是一个开源项目,名为"spf13-hugo"。这个项目基于Go语言,是一个静态站点生成器,具体版本为0.14。从描述 "Go's Static Site Generator Hugo 0.14 Released" ...
开源项目“m3ng9i-ran.zip”包含了一个名为“Ran”的简单静态Web服务器,它是用Go语言编写的。Go,也被称为Golang,是Google开发的一种静态类型的编程语言,强调简洁、效率和可移植性,尤其适合构建网络服务和工具。...
开源项目“juicemia-quasimodo.zip”是基于GitHub上的一个名为“juicemia/quasimodo”的项目,其核心目标是简化Hugo网站部署到Amazon S3的过程。Hugo是一个静态站点生成器,它允许用户使用Markdown和其他模板语言...
标题中的"CORY"是一个专注于前端开发的开源库,特别设计用于生成静态站点。在现代Web开发中,静态站点生成器(Static Site Generator, SSG)已经变得越来越流行,因为它们能够提供高效、安全且易于部署的解决方案。...
这意味着无论你的开源项目托管在哪个平台上,都可以享受到gitee.net提供的数据图表服务。开放的API(如压缩包中的"open-gitee-api-master")使得开发者可以方便地将gitee.net的功能集成到自己的应用或网站中,自定义...
开源项目通常通过像SourceForge这样的平台进行托管和协作,这样开发者可以共同贡献代码,一起完善项目。 接下来,CRM系统(Customer Relationship Management,客户关系管理)是一种帮助企业管理与客户间的互动的...
虚拟目录允许将不同的物理路径映射到同一个站点下,使多个项目可以共享一个站点。在C# IIS管理器中,可以方便地添加、删除和修改虚拟目录,包括设置别名、物理路径以及权限。 五、开源的优势 开源意味着源代码的...
【标题】"kaitlynelemmons.github.io:CSC 342 项目的 Github 托管站点" 提供了一个在 Github 上公开展示 CSC 342 课程项目的地方。这通常意味着该站点包含了与计算机科学相关的内容,可能是学生作业、项目演示或课程...
【标题】: "PyTube:使用Python和Flask构建的多媒体托管站点" ...通过这些文件,开发者可以了解并参与到PyTube项目的开发和维护中,同时也可以将其作为学习Python Flask开发多媒体托管站点的实例。
Waarp是以前的GoldenGate项目的新家,第一个是Waarp R66,Waarp R66是一种开源文件传输监视器,可用于生产,并具有安全性,弹性,集成性,可移植性,性能,适应性。 它是完全开源和免费的,没有任何使用限制。 该...